What Karen Walrond Speaks On
Karen Walrond’s keynotes are built around what she calls the Lightmakers Philosophy – a practical framework for helping people identify their unique gifts and deploy them in ways that serve their communities. The philosophy is grounded in her research, her own story, and her extensive work with organizations and individuals navigating the challenge of belonging in workplaces and communities that were not always designed with them in mind.
Her core topics include the practice of belonging – not as an aspiration or a policy, but as a set of specific, repeatable behaviors that leaders and organizations can choose. She addresses the art of seeing people – what it means to genuinely recognize the gifts and dignity of every person in a room, and what shifts when organizations do that consistently. And she speaks to what she calls “the crisis of joy” in professional life – the depletion and disconnection that comes from doing meaningful work without the conditions that make it sustainable.
